Chelsea are considering Leicester’s James Maddison as a potential replacement for Hakim Ziyech, according to Football.London‘s Chris Wheatley.

The website’s Arsenal correspondent claims that both the Gunners and the Blues are keeping tabs on the England international:

Supporters on Twitter are not particularly happy with the links to Maddison, with many feeling that Ziyech is a much better player than the 24-year-old:

There have been numerous reports now that manager Thomas Tuchel is considering letting Ziyech leave, with the likes of AC Milan and Napoli said to be interested in the Moroccan international.

Considering the number of options that Chelsea have in forward areas, though, you would think that replacing him wouldn’t be a priority anyway, especially if they are looking at someone like Maddison who likes to play in central areas.

Tuchel already has Mason Mount for that role, and while Maddison’s stats last season were pretty impressive (11 goals and 10 assists in all competitions), the transfer budget could be better spent in strengthening other positions.
